Important Note

North Dakota requires that certain preservice courses be completed through the State of North Dakota only. ChildCareEd does not provide these state-specific preservice courses.

However, all other annual, ongoing, and professional development training hours may be completed through ChildCareEd and are accepted by the North Dakota Early Childhood Workforce Registry.

North Dakota Annual Training Requirements

Annual training hours in North Dakota vary based on the number of hours you work per week.

Center, Preschool, & School-Age Program Staff

  • 30–40 hours/week → 13 hours annually
  • 20–30 hours/week → 11 hours annually
  • 10–20 hours/week → 9 hours annually
  • Less than 10 hours/week → 7 hours annually

In-Home Providers

  • 30–40 hours/week → 8 hours annually
  • 20–30 hours/week → 6 hours annually
  • 10–20 hours/week → 4 hours annually
  • Less than 10 hours/week → 2 hours annually

CDA Credential Training for North Dakota Providers

North Dakota accepts the Child Development Associate (CDA) Credential as a recognized qualification for child care staff. Directors and supervisors must hold a CDA or higher plus at least one year of experience.
